Periscope

BoopFashionista Periscope 2015
Now the part I have been looking forward to…my Periscope year in review! On the 16th of April I spotted a tweet from somebody along the lines of “Check out Periscope, it’s the next big thing.” So I downloaded the mobile app and did my first live broadcast entitled “Working on the blog!”…fast forward over 8 months later and I am now a daily broadcaster on the app with a community of over 13,000 BoopTroop followers on my Periscope channel @BoopFashionista. What I love most about this part of my year in review is that before April I had no idea that Periscope was going to come along and impact my life in so many positive ways.
I have had the best best best fun live-streaming and sharing my daily coffee scopes, event coverage, travel scopes, blogging scopes and whatever the heck I am up to on the app. I love Periscope. I love that it is real, live and that there is no editing involved. I scope every day whether I am wrapped up to the nines in a beanie, scarf and cosy coat with zero makeup on or whether I am heading out to an exciting event in London. You guys have taken the time to really get to know me and to come on this journey with me. My followers have been so amazing, kind-hearted and supportive. I try to reply to every DM and email I receive because honestly it means the world to me and I thank you from the bottom of my heart for joining my broadcasts and sending your kind words. I am so happy to be able to share my little part of this world with you all with a smile 🙂
Periscope has also allowed me to enter the world of public speaking and I was thrilled to speak at the Irish Bloggers Conference and the OMiG networking event in Ireland earlier this year. A highlight was also when I was invited as a KeyNote speaker at the first Periscope Rally event in Germany. I also took part in the first ever Scope Day where I was a featured London broadcaster for the event. I have broadcasted on the app in the following countries this year: Ireland, UK, India, Holland, Germany, France & New York. Who knows where 2016 will take us!
